1. Licensing and Certification
Why Licensing Matters
A certified specialist has actually satisfied certain criteria set by regional authorities regarding safety, expertise, and quality of work. This licensing works as evidence that they are gotten the job.
How to Verify Licensing
- Check with your neighborhood licensing board. Ask for their license number. Verify if there are any issues versus them.
2. Insurance coverage Coverage
Importance of Insurance
Insurance secures both you and the contractor in case of crashes or problems during the building and construction procedure. A licensed professional needs to have responsibility insurance coverage and worker's payment insurance.
Questions to Ask Pertaining to Insurance
- Can you offer evidence of insurance? What does your insurance cover?

6. Created Quotes and Contracts
Importance of Comprehensive Estimates
A composed price quote shields both parties by offering clearness on prices involved home remodeling Massachusetts in the job. It should lay out products required, labor expenses, timeline price quotes, and payment schedules.
What Should Be Consisted of in Contracts?
A solid contract must include:
- Project scope Start and conclusion dates Payment terms Warranty information
7. Repayment Structure
Understanding Repayment Terms
Knowing exactly how payments will certainly be structured helps stop misunderstandings in the future. The majority of specialists will certainly request for a down payment upfront adhered to by turning point repayments or final settlement upon completion.
